Job Summary

Kitsap Mental Health Services is seeking a dedicated and compassionate Therapist to join our PACT (Program for Assertive Community Treatment) team. As a key member of our multidisciplinary team, you will provide comprehensive mental health services to clients managing severe mental health disorders, fostering recovery and independence.

Key Responsibilities
  • Assess client strengths and needs, driving team activities and periodic mental status assessments.
  • Develop, implement, and evaluate treatment plans collaboratively with clients and team members, utilizing recovery-oriented and strengths-based approaches.
  • Provide individual therapy, psychoeducation, symptom management, and crisis intervention using evidence-based practices like Cognitive Behavioral Therapy and Motivational Interviewing.
  • Compile detailed psychosocial assessments for the PACT Comprehensive Assessment, aiding in formulating client treatment plans.
  • Conduct daily team meetings and treatment planning reviews, providing input on symptom management strategies and crisis intervention plans.
  • Coordinate with KMHS co-occurring treatment staff and engage clients in accessing support groups to support co-occurring recovery.
  • Monitor and evaluate client compliance with treatment plans and conduct mental status examinations in collaboration with the PACT supervisor.
Requirements
  • Master's Degree in Psychology, social services, or behavioral health field or must meet waiver criteria of RCW 71.24.260.
  • Minimum one year job-related experience.
  • Agency Affiliated Counselor License or higher.
  • Ability to react quickly and perceive environmental stimuli accurately.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ience in individual and group therapy and outpatient treatment for individuals with psychotic disorders.
  • Understanding of the co-occurring recovery process and how to support it from a therapist role.
  • Experience with the theory and practice of Cognitive Behavioral Therapy, Dialectical Behavior Therapy, Motivational Interviewing, and co-occurring substance use disorders.
